SMU vs. Tech: Mustangs' defense has new look
5:54 PM Sat, Sep 13, 2008 | Permalink | Yahoo! Buzz
Bobbi Roquemore E-mail News tips

SMU will come out in a different defensive set than it used in the previous two games.

The Mustangs will use a 3-3-5, with redshirt freshman Chris Castro (Allen) as the fifth defensive back.

So the starting defense appears as follows: DE Anthony Sowe, NT Evan Huahulu, DE Youri Yemga, LB Pete Fleps, LB Justin Smart, LB Julian Herron, DB Chris Castro, CB Derrius Bell, FS Tyler Jones, SS Rock Dennis and CB Bryan McCann.

In other personnel notes, C Mitch Enright will not start due to a hand injury, and true freshman Blake McJunkin (Plano) gets the nod. Senior RT Tommy Poynter is out (undisclosed injury), and senior Vincent Chase will start there.
